Why People Seek Clinical Addiction Detox

Individuals considering the Renew clinical addiction detox centre often recognise that detoxing without supervision can feel unsafe or overwhelming. Therefore, clinical settings appeal because they prioritise medical awareness and structured support.

People commonly seek clinical detox when they experience:

  • Severe or unpredictable withdrawal symptoms

  • Physical dependence on substances

  • Anxiety about stopping substance use alone

  • Previous complications during withdrawal

Clinical Detox as Part of a Broader Recovery Pathway

Clinical detox rarely functions as a complete treatment. Instead, it often serves as a foundation for further care. Consequently, individuals exploring the Renew clinical addiction detox centre may expect guidance beyond stabilisation.

This pathway often involves:

  • Introduction to therapeutic treatment options

  • Clear recommendations for next-stage care

  • Support transitioning into rehabilitation or recovery programmes

  • Continued monitoring during early recovery

  • Planning that extends beyond detox
